286 sufficient livelihood and maintenance and them the said negroes Davy Fanny and Mary I do declare to be free manumitted and discharged from and after the periods above mentioned from all manner of servitude or service to me my executors or administrators forever In Testimony whereof I have hereunto set my hand and affixed my seal this thirty first day of May in the year of our Lord one thousand eight hundred and twenty four signed sealed & delivered in the presence of us Margaret Miller (seal) Gideon White Louis Gassaway At the foot of the aforegoing Deed was thus written to wit Anne Arundel County Viz Be it remembered that on this thirty first day of May one thousand eight hundred and twenty four personally appears margaret Miller before me the subscriber a Justice of the peace for the County aforesaid and acknowledges the aforegoing instrument of writing to be her act and Deed Chd Gideon White 3½ Recorded the 1st day of June 1824 This Indenture witnesseth that I Nicholas D Warfield of Bela of anne arundel County & State of Maryland for and in Consideration of the sum of one dollar to me in hand paid at and before the ensealing and delivery of these presents the receipt whereof is hereby acknowledged have released from Slavery manumitted and set free and by these presents do release from slavery manumit and set free my negro boy William at the age of thirty one years he being fifteen years of age the twelth day of (June) |
